The rise of artificial intelligence is inextricably linked to cloud movements. Sophisticated AI models require significant processing capacity and huge data stores that are difficult to manage on-premises. Shifting workloads to the cloud provides the flexibility and affordability necessary to train and run these powerful AI solutions. Without the framework of the cloud, the current AI boom simply wouldn’t be feasible and innovation would be severely limited.

Safeguarding Your Artificial Intelligence Outlook: Cloud Relocation Optimal Practices
As companies increasingly rely on AI-powered applications, effectively transferring these workloads to the digital realm becomes critical. Emphasize authentication management to avoid unauthorized access. Utilize strong encryption methods both at rest and being transferred. Periodically assess your digital security stance and leverage intelligent tools to identify and respond possible threats. Lastly, ensure adherence with relevant regulatory guidelines throughout the complete relocation process.
